She burns
Fire in the night
The flame dims
Fatigue rides in her eyes
I hunt her
Desire my delight
She calls to me
Through lips never parted
I crawl through jagged arrows
To cradle her in my arms
We come together
Flame and Desire
Yet there are no explosions
Just appetites warmed
